What is it?

Armagetron Advanced 0.2.8+ has a feature to record a play session. This session can later be used by developers to find and squash bugs.

Creating a Debug Recording

All Platforms

Use your shell to pass some command line arguments to armagetron: To record: armagetronad --record filename
To playback: armagetronad --playback filename [--fast-forward SECONDS]

where filename is the name of the file to be recorded to / played back.

(On windows, you can issue shell commands by entering them in startmenu->run. Remember to give the full path to armagetronad.exe if you do that.)

Mac OS X

Use the helper application included with the game to start or playback an Armagetron Advanced recording. The application has a feature to compress a recording using bzip2 after Armagetron Advanced quits, so you can upload to the forums easily. It also will decompress a bzip2 or zip file for playback.

Windows

The beta release installer creates links in the start menu to record/playback to/from a file called recording.aarec that is located in the program directory.
